White According to 2017 information, white is one of the most prominent vehicle color in 7 out of nine nations checked by PPG Industries, an American Lot of money 500 paint firm. In North America, white continues to be one of the most popular vehicle color in 2017, coming in at around 25 percent.
With each other, these 4 colors amount to about 70 percent of the complete world auto manufacturing. White is the most popular auto shade.
It's likewise been figured out that white is the safest shade auto to drive. White is taken into consideration to be one of the most noticeable color when traveling in virtually all problems, with the exception of snow. Silver is also taken into consideration to be a good auto color since of its ability to mirror light during the night.

Image from Wikipedia through Axion23. This myth has been considered "an urban myth," indicating that although it's been distributed as true, it isn't. The truth is that according to 2014 data, white was the most ticketed vehicle color. White vehicles made up 19 percent of the complete traffic citations in one research study, although red did come in second at 16 percent.
